How did I become interested in Japanese Fashion?
All my life I've been influenced by japanese culture because of my father's personal interest and also profession as a photographer and later itamae (a sushi chef) . Growing up, my father introduced me to various interesting things from Japan like toys, video games, movies, animation, and culture itself. I never realized I was so heavily influenced by him for so long until I found baby photos of myself in traditional Japanese clothing. Sailor Moon, Cardcaptor Sakura, Final Fantasy, Hayao Miyazaki etc. were all introduced to me by him and if it weren't for him, I may have never gotten a chance to get so deep into Japanese fashion when I discovered it. I was very into chinese street fashion and also liked flipping through my mother's vogue, etc. fashion magazines during middle school. From there, my first exposure to the oshare side of j-fashion would have to have been through music in Japanese films. I first became interested in visual kei and then lolita. After that, my interest in the fashion spread to all types such as gyaru, ulzzang, fairy kei, cult party kei, dolly kei, gothic, nu-goth, etc. Though j-fashion is not the only style fashion I like, it is for the most part my favourite go-to fashion and many ideas of my fashion ideas stem from it.
